A traditional recipe for preparing pickled eggplant at home, a delectable and versatile option perfect for any time of the day. Pickled eggplants are not only delicious but also convenient, serving as a quick addition to sandwiches or as a delightful side dish, complementing any chosen garnish.
How to Make Pickled Eggplant
Ideal for an appetizer or starter, pickled eggplants stand as a timeless classic with various preparation versions. While eggplants can be prepared raw, a longer resting time is required. Here’s a classic recipe with basic ingredients and a step-by-step guide:
Ingredients:
- 3 large eggplants
- 2 cups of apple cider vinegar
- 3 cups of olive oil
- Fresh herbs like mint
- Fresh oregano to taste
- 3 bay leaves
- 3 garlic cloves
